Convention "On the Rights of the Child"
For the purposes of this Convention, the child is every human being until the age of 18, if, according to the law applicable to this child, he does not reach the age of majority earlier. The participating states respect and ensure all the rights provided for by this Convention, for every child who are within their jurisdiction, without any discrimination, regardless of the race, color, gender, language, religion, political or other beliefs, national, ethnic or social origin, property status, state of health and the birth of the child, his parents or legal guardians or any other circumstances. The participating states take all the necessary measures to ensure the protection of the child from all forms of discrimination or punishment based on the status, activity, expressed views or beliefs of the child, parents of the child, legal guardians or other family members.
